1. Enhances Visual Appeal and Design Integrity

The first and perhaps most noticeable benefit of good architectural lighting is its ability to enhance the visual appeal of a structure. Whether it’s a home, office, museum, or shopping mall, lighting helps to highlight the architecture’s best features. Shadows and angles can be manipulated to add depth, drama, and warmth.

Using the 3 benefits of good architectural lighting as a foundation, one quickly realizes how critical proper lighting is in revealing textures, defining structures, and showcasing the materials used in the construction. For example, recessed lighting can accentuate textured walls, while uplighting draws the eye to unique ceiling features or artworks.

Architectural lighting allows designers to emphasize design elements that might otherwise be overlooked. It frames the user’s experience from the moment they step into the space. With technologies like LED color-tuning and smart controls, today’s lighting designers can align the lighting scheme perfectly with the architectural intent—making it more dynamic and immersive.


2. Improves Functionality and Space Usability

Among the 3 benefits of good architectural lighting, improved functionality stands out as a practical advantage. Well-planned lighting ensures that each area within a space is optimally lit for its intended use. In homes, that means bright, focused lighting in kitchens and softer ambient lighting in bedrooms or living rooms. In commercial settings, such as offices, effective lighting boosts productivity by reducing eye strain and supporting natural circadian rhythms.

Architectural lighting can even enhance safety and navigation. Think of parking lots, stairwells, or hallways—spaces that often depend on strategic lighting to ensure people can move safely and comfortably. Adaptive lighting systems that respond to occupancy or daylight changes can further increase efficiency and usability.

In retail environments, lighting influences customer behavior. Bright, warm lighting makes products more appealing, guides foot traffic, and encourages longer visits. These real-world applications reinforce how one of the 3 benefits of good architectural lighting—functional enhancement—is vital across industries.


3. Boosts Energy Efficiency and Sustainability

Energy efficiency is a growing concern in today’s world, and one of the most impactful yet often overlooked ways to achieve sustainability is through intelligent lighting. Among the 3 benefits of good architectural lighting, energy savings and sustainability can have long-term cost and environmental benefits.

Architectural lighting solutions today are designed with energy conservation in mind. By incorporating LED fixtures, daylight sensors, dimming controls, and zoning capabilities, designers can drastically reduce a building’s energy footprint. For instance, daylight harvesting technology adjusts artificial lighting based on the level of natural light available—ensuring minimal energy waste.

Moreover, sustainable architectural lighting often involves materials and designs that promote durability and low maintenance, which reduces the need for frequent replacements and the associated costs. As governments and corporations continue to push green building initiatives, investing in energy-efficient architectural lighting isn’t just smart—it’s essential.


The Psychological and Emotional Benefits

While the 3 benefits of good architectural lighting typically revolve around design, functionality, and efficiency, it’s worth noting the indirect psychological and emotional perks. Lighting influences mood, perception, and even mental well-being.

Incorporating biophilic design principles, for instance, blends natural light with built environments, helping reduce stress and enhance satisfaction. Human-centric lighting systems that mimic the sun’s natural progression through the day can help regulate sleep and productivity, especially in environments with limited access to daylight.
